Can a Weight Distribution WD System be Used with Air Bags  

Question:

1200 lbs tongue weight on my 1/2 ton has sag. Can I use airbags also?

Expert Reply:

Some Weight Distribution (WD) systems allow you to utilize air bags on your vehicle but if you have a properly rated WD system your sag should not be an issue.

You want to make sure your WD system has a Tongue Weight (TW) range that the Total Tongue Weight (TTW) of your towing setup falls in the middle of. To find the TTW of your towing setup you will need to add the TW of your fully loaded and ready-to-go trailer along with the weight of any cargo behind the rear axle of your tow vehicle. Keep in mind that a properly loaded trailer will have a TW that is 10-15% of the loaded weight of your trailer.

If you would like to use an air bag system then I recommend using the Strait-Line WD # RP66130 which has a TW range of 800 lbs - 1,500 lbs. The instructions state that you need to bring the tow vehicle to a level ride before installing the system.

This system comes with everything that you need aside from a shank like part # RP54970 and a hitch ball like part # C40030.
